Bandwidth and Resolution

Choosing the right HDMI 2.1 cable means paying close attention to its bandwidth capabilities, as this directly impacts the resolution and smoothness of your picture. HDMI 2.1 cables support up to 48Gbps, which is essential for transmitting high-resolution content like 8K at 60Hz or 4K at 120Hz. Higher bandwidth allows for smoother playback at higher refresh rates, reducing lag and motion blur during gaming or streaming. To guarantee reliable signal transmission, especially for demanding formats like dynamic HDR and high-bit-depth colors, you need a certified cable with the full 48Gbps bandwidth. This not only guarantees current performance but also future-proofs your setup for upcoming high-resolution devices and systems that require increased data transfer rates.

Build Quality and Durability

Building a high-quality HDMI 2.1 cable means prioritizing durability and construction materials that can withstand regular use. Look for cables with sturdy features like nylon braiding, aluminum alloy casings, and gold-plated connectors, which resist wear and corrosion. The best cables are rated for over 10,000 to 25,000 flex cycles, ensuring they hold up through frequent plugging and unplugging without degrading performance. Reinforced designs with anti-bending features help prevent damage at stress points, maintaining stable signal transmission over time. Additionally, robust shielding—such as triple-layer shielding or ferrite beads—reduces electromagnetic interference and signal loss. These durable construction elements contribute to a longer lifespan, less frequent replacements, and consistently high-quality performance for your streaming and gaming needs.

Length and Flexibility

Since longer HDMI 2.1 cables can sometimes lead to signal degradation, it’s essential to pay attention to their design and shielding. Cables over 10 feet may experience signal loss if not properly shielded or built for high bandwidths like 48Gbps. Flexibility also matters; braided or nylon jackets tend to withstand frequent bending and routing, reducing internal wire damage. However, stiffer cables often offer better shielding but can be harder to manage in tight spaces. For superior performance, pick cables that support high flexibility without sacrificing signal integrity, especially for 8K and 4K high-refresh-rate content. Proper length and flexibility help prevent signal loss, interference, and ensure a reliable, high-quality streaming and gaming experience.

Certification and Standards

When choosing an HDMI 2.1 cable, confirming its certification is essential to guarantee it meets the necessary performance standards. Certified cables ensure support for 48Gbps bandwidth, enabling high-resolution and high-refresh-rate content like 8K@60Hz and 4K@120Hz. They also support advanced features such as Dynamic HDR, eARC, VRR, and QFT, which rely on strict compliance with HDMI standards. Verifying certification through QR codes or official labels helps certify authenticity and adherence to these standards, reducing the risk of signal issues. Non-certified cables might look similar but often can’t reliably handle the bandwidth or features they claim, leading to potential problems with high-quality video and audio. Prioritizing certification guarantees compatibility and future-proofing your setup.
